Glanbaiden House

This was named after the Baiden Brook which separated the old counties of Monmouthshire and Brecnockshire. Past residents have included Lieutenant Colonel Backhouse Church and Mr Victor Bosanquet, who was the chief constable of Monmouthshire from 1891 until his death in 1936.
